White Water Rafting - Sarapiqui River Class III-IV

Summary Description

We will pick you up from your hotel around 8 am and will head on over to the river giving you a tour of the region as we pass by different landscapes.  Once at the put in of the river, you will be introduced to your guide and given your equipment.  Following a thorough safety talk and paddling technique practice, you will be ready to go rafting.  What is unique about rafting with us is that we combine the class III-IV section of the river with the best rapids of the class II-III section, giving you more time on the river than anyone else. 

You will descend for about 3-3.5 hours down challenging and adrenaline pumping white water, big fun waves and drops nestled in the beautiful Costa Rica rain forest.  When you are not busy paddling, we will point out to you all the wildlife we see since this river runs close to the San Juan-La Selva Biological Reserve famous for bird migration.  Half way, you will stop for a fruit break and eat come delicious fresh local pineapple, watermelon or mango. At the end of the tour, you will visit a local family run restaurant called a Soda where they will prepare for you a delicious traditional lunch cooked on a wooden stove before your one hour ride back to La Fortuna.
